MEMO — Key-card stock for the Dunridge site

Heads up: the blank key-card stock for the new Dunridge site landed yesterday. It's the small sealed carton on the cage shelf — please don't open it, security wants the seals intact. A courier from Hartwell Secure picks it up tomorrow around noon. At hand-over, tell the driver the following:

handover note for kagep-kagup: the holok holdor courier leaves the rusix sorox fenwyn ledger at gate 3590 under passcode 092644

// Fixture: AddressAutocompleteWidget (Project Larkspur)
// Covers the debounce path discussed at last week's sync: we simulate
// three rapid keystrokes against the Meridale suggestion service and
// assert only the final query fires. The mock gateway requires live
// auth even in CI, per the Quillford platform policy.
// The token used by this fixture follows below.

session JWT of yawep-yawep = eyJhbGciOiJIUzI1NiIsInR5cCI6IkpXVCJ9.eyJzdWIiOiI3pWF3_In0.aXYsHiog

- [ ] Step 7: Archive cold storage buckets (Glacierline tier). Confirm both ceremony witnesses are present, verify bucket manifests match the Oxbow ledger, then seal the archive key shares. Plugin authors may observe but not handle shares. Once sealed, the archive index itself is encrypted and can only be reopened with the passphrase below.

vault phrase of badup-hahig = tamael-aldael-kelmir-istael-fenok-istwyn-tamius-jorath-oliion

Runbook: Pellidor thumbnail queue. When backlog exceeds five thousand items, workers in the Quenmoor cluster scale out automatically, but only if the poison-message ratio stays under two percent. Check dead-letter depth before scaling manually, and never drain the queue during a resize. The queue's active configuration values are reproduced below.

service settings:
[quenath]
host = quenath.zemvarcorp.corp
user = quenath_svc
database = quenath_prod